Default 92-96 Prelude question: auto and manual have the same engine harness?

Hey all,

A guy who emailed me is in need of some help. He has a 96 Prelude that has an auto tranny. He parted out hsi car because he wrecked it. However, he was able to fix it. Now he needs to buy a new engine harness to put the engine back in. He found one from a 96 Prelude Si manual tranny, however, he wants to know if it is the same one as the one that comes in the auto Prelude. Is it?

It is my understanding that the Preludes share the same engine harness; the difference lies in the tranny. The auto tranny has its own ECU. Correct?

no its not the same. the auto tranny requires that the sensors be plugged in, and those plugs are a part of the engine harness.
